Boaz, WI Demographics

The total population of Boaz is estimated to be 136 with 75 males (55.15%) and 61 females (44.85%). There are 14 less females than males in Boaz.
The median household income in Boaz was $51,175 in 2021, which marked an an increase of 3,017(6.26%) from $48,158 in 2020. This income is 68.59% of the U.S. median household income of $74,606 (all incomes in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ars).
Per the latest American Community Survey by the Census Bureau, Boaz sees its highest median household income among householders in the age group of 45 to 64 years old, at $77,353. Overall, the median household income for the village of Boaz stands at $51,175.
In Boaz, the median income for all workers aged 15 years and older, regardless of work hours, was $35,805 for males and $23,870 for females. However, when specifically considering full-time, year-round workers within the same age group, the median income was $49,992 for males and $33,779 for females.
In Boaz, population is primarily represented by White households, reporting a median income of $50,499.
In 2022, the population of Boaz was 124, a 1.59% decrease year-by-year from 2021. Previously, in 2021, Boaz's population was 126, a decline of 0.79% compared to a population of 127 in 2020.
The median age in Boaz, WI is 56.5, as per 2021 ACS 5-Year Estimates. Of the total population, 16.78% were under the age of 15, 10.74% aged 15 to 29, 45.64% aged 30 to 64, 22.15% aged 65 to 84, and 4.70% were 85 years of age and older.
Racial distribution of Boaz population: 92.62% are White and 7.38% are multiracial.
